The Chair of Saint Peter (& Other Games)
Behind closed doors, the Vatican awaits white smoke. But this conclave doesn’t just pray — it plays. Ritual collides with absurdity as cardinals battle through games of chance, strategy, and silliness to claim the throne. The Chair of Saint Peter (& Other Games) is a sharp, satirical new work from WA’s next generation of theatre-makers, fusing comedy and critique to interrogate faith, authority, and complicity. World premiering at Summer Nights 2026, this 50-minute proof-of-concept invites audiences to laugh, question, and reflect on why we follow, and who we let lead.

Sanna Ansaldo is a multilingual performer, director, and theatre-maker of Swedish and Italian heritage, based in Boorloo/Perth. She trained at Calle Flygare Theatre School in Stockholm and is completing her Bachelor of Performing Arts (Performance Making) at WAAPA. In Sweden, her credits include August: Osage County (Alias Teatern, 2023), Never Have I Ever (2023), Oaktsam (2023), and Netflix/Viaplay’s Fartblinda (Blinded) S3 (2023-2024). In Australia, she has performed and directed for WAAPA’s TILT Season (2025) and appeared in Katzenmusik (dir. Emily McLean, 2025). As a maker, Sanna creates work that weaves ritual, satire, and physical storytelling with her background in yoga, movement, and intercultural practice. She is the creator and director of The Chair of Saint Peter (& Other Games)
